District 9
I had some time off today and decided to watch a movie. Settled on District 9. It looked interesting enough from the advert and it is only showing in a few cinemas which meant I could also avoid the crowd.
District 9 turns out to be one of the best movies I have seen so far. It is a thought-provoking movie. It makes you ponder long after the movie has finished screening. District 9 is a sci-fi movie filmed as a mock documentary by first-time filmmaker, Neill Blomkamp and with first-time actor, Sharlto Copley casted as the lead role, a goofy government officer. It is almost like Cloverfield, another sci-fi movie as seen from a videocam but District 9 is tons better!! As the movie advances, it makes you ponder long and deep about issues such as rights as a group, rights as an individual, segregation, supremacy, what is humanity. There is also the exploration of emotions. Before you dismiss it as one of those boring thinking movies, there is action too and pretty cool. :) District 9 is definitely engaging both in terms of the drama as well as the action. Oh, but if you can't stand blood and gore, District 9 might not be so suitable for you. If you enjoyed movies like Cloverfield and The Blair Witch Project, you will definitely find District 9 your cup of tea.
District 9 is about a race of aliens who became stranded on Earth, and most refreshingly, in South Africa. The humans designated a district (thus, the name of the movie, District 9) for the aliens to live in but they are kept segregated from the humans. A series of events followed when the aliens were being moved from their slums in District 9 to a new district... Enjoy the trailer.
